  • Honestly, I'm surprised that OP is being so obtuse about this. It's clear once you're familiar with intersectionality, but I think it could do well to be explained at least a little bit for those who aren't.

    Essentially, the argument is that feminism, while a good force, needs anti-racism to maximize it's potential, just as it needs support for LGBTQ+ rights, since a lot of people are impacted by racism, homophobia, transphobia etc. Focusing largely on cis-het white middle-class women does help them, but we need those other elements too to be able to truly liberate people

  • I've had a bunch of issues with my GTX 1080 before I switched to an AMD RX 5700 XT. I love it, but I recently put the 1080 back in use for a headless game streaming server for my brother. It's been working really well, handling both rendering and encoding at 1080p without issue, so I guess I've arrived at the same conclusion. They don't really care about desktop usage, but once you're not directly interacting with a display server on an Nvidia GPU, it's fine.

  • Yeah, I get that. I was daily driving Guix for quite a long time and really enjoyed it. As I understand it shares a lot of code with Nix. It's just been a bit hard to integrate with a lot of the software I run due to it not being compatible with the traditional filesystem hierarchy. This is obviously a selling point for Nix/Guix as it frees it to try new ideas, but makes it harder for me to run my music production software for example, which I can't run in flatpak officially and since it Just Works™ on Debian, I'm happy with it. Maybe I'll get into it sometime again as the community seems to have grown a lot, and I've looked into running Nix on top of my Debian install.

  • Chiming in to say that Debian is great if you're comfortable with how Ubuntu works, as Ubuntu is basically Debian + Corporate support + Snaps.

    I switched all my machines from Ubuntu to Debian during the Red Hat debacle, since I don't have faith in corporate distros anymore and generally prefer the more democratic approach that the Debian foundation takes.
